Annulments

An Annulment is where the marriage is dissolved but it differs from divorce in that the marriage was considered never to have taken place.  If there are enough grounds for an Annulment to be obtained, the Court will grant a Decree of Nullity dissolving the marriage. 

Annulments are very rare and indeed are very difficult to obtain.  In most cases it is preferable to obtain a divorce rather than an annulment.
